The flying wing UAV, in particular, has gained popularity due to its unique design and capabilities. These drones are characterized by their sleek, wing-shaped bodies that allow for enhanced speed, maneuverability, and stealth. Flying wing UAVs are often used for reconnaissance, surveillance, and intelligence-gathering missions, making them invaluable assets for military forces seeking to gather information without risking personnel.
Another type of military drone that has seen increased use is the Target drone. These drones are designed to simulate enemy aircraft or missiles for training purposes. By using Target drones, military pilots can hone their combat skills in realistic scenarios without the need for actual hostile aircraft. The development of advanced Target drone technology has significantly improved the effectiveness of military training exercises.

While military drones offer numerous benefits, they also raise significant concerns regarding ethics, privacy, and safety. The use of drones in combat operations has sparked debates about the morality of remote warfare and the potential for civilian casualties. Additionally, the widespread use of drones for surveillance purposes has raised concerns about privacy rights and government intrusion.
